Damsel in distress? Hardly!

The Independent Princess is a coloring book and adventure story all in one. A feisty heroine, a long-lost queen, evil villains, and a dashing Scotsman bring this colorable tale to life. Antonia Barclay is a determined young woman who is more interested in horses than dances. Soon after learning she is the secret daughter of Mary, Queen of Scots, she is taken prisoner by the same evil villains who kidnapped her mother. Refusing to be a damsel in distress, Antonia knocks down one obstacle after another, meeting every challenge with bold determination, quick wit, and skilled horsemanship. The Independent Princess is an unusual take on a historical romance whose readers–and colorers–will be delighted by this charming story with a surprise modern ending. Readers may also enjoy the original Antonia Barclay story in the novel, Antonia Barclay and Her Scottish Claymore.
